AI in Cloud Forensics: Investigating Evidence Across Distributed Environments
As businesses move to cloud platforms, digital evidence becomes scattered across virtual machines, containers, databases, and logs. Traditional forensic methods struggle in such dynamic environments — and that’s where AI steps in.
-
Automated Log Analysis
AI rapidly scans millions of cloud logs to identify suspicious access attempts, privilege escalations, and abnormal API calls. -
User Behavior Profiling
Machine learning builds behavioral baselines for cloud users and flags anomalies that may indicate compromised accounts or insider threats. -
Virtual Machine (VM) Snapshot Analysis
AI helps investigators compare VM snapshots, detect unauthorized changes, and recover forensic artifacts even after rapid scaling or resets. -
Cloud Malware Detection
AI analyzes workloads to detect hidden malicious processes running inside cloud instances or containers. -
Data Movement Tracking
AI maps unusual data transfers between cloud regions, storage buckets, or third-party services, helping trace exfiltration attempts.
πΉ Bottom Line: AI transforms cloud forensics by bringing visibility, speed, and intelligence to investigations across complex, distributed environments.
